Why Lifting Electromagnets Are Important

A lifting electromagnet is an electrically operated device to lift ferrous metal items by magnetic force. These systems can lift from steel bars and plates to bundles of pipe and scrap metal. The advantages are many: enhanced safety, less manpower, quicker material handling, and minimal physical contact with sharp or hazardous surfaces.


Yet, the selection of an appropriate lifting magnet should be based on a large number of pertinent operating parameters. This failure can lead to safety risks, equipment inefficiency, or product damage.

Parametric Considerations for Selecting Lifting Electromagnet

Load Characteristics

The shape and condition of the surface of the load, weight, dimensions, and shape determine the kind of magnet appropriate. Round or irregular forms are harder to handle than flat shapes. Paint or rust coatings on metal may also influence the strength of the magnetic field.

Duty Cycle and Power Source

It's crucial to recognise the lifting cycle. Is it continuous lifting that will need the magnet, or is it periodic lifting? Electromagnets employed for lifting need a constant power supply, and hence structures must provide access to electricity and battery backup systems where required.

Lifting Environment

Will the magnet be in an indoor or outdoor setting? High-temperature use or exposure to dust and moisture? Environmental operating conditions drive housing design and insulation needs to accommodate harsh environments and safety.

System Integration

Compatibility with installed equipment like cranes, forklifts, or excavators will be necessary for the magnet. Adequate mounting provisions and electrical compatibility are necessary to integrate directly in place without conflict.

Safety Features 

Equipment using magnetic lifting needs to have fail-safe mechanisms. If the electricity supply is removed, redundant systems (such as load holding briefly) need to be in place so that a disaster is avoided. To this extent, electro permanent lifting magnets have an important benefit.

The Growing Role of Electro Permanent Lifting Magnets

Electro permanent lift magnets have become increasingly popular over the last few years as they take advantage of the advantages of both electromagnets and permanent magnets. They are operated by electricity to turn on and off, but not to sustain the magnetic field. Thus, during a power outage, the magnet still clings to its load firmly, ensuring the safety of mission-critical operations.


These machines are power-efficient, eco-friendly, and durable as they generate very little heat. They are optimally used in lifting heavy steel plates, billets, or other heavy products in high-speed production lines.
